Description
We carried out the experiments on separations of fatty acids by lithium salts, using the oils of vegesable and animal kingdoms (vegetable 14, animal 13 varities). The lithium salts of fatty acids were prepared with Li_2SO_4 and LiOH, then separated roughly into two fractions, namely, water-insoluble and -soluble fractions. The former was further separated by the solubility in alcoho, the latter, after being detached lithium, with petroleum ether and benzene. On the whole, the main fractions were the water, alcohol-insoluble lithium salts, of the water soluble part, mainly the petroleum ether-soluble. However, the amounts of each fractions were indefinite according to the oils ; especially, in the case of the rat's depot fat, a considerable difference was noted by the feeding condition, diets fed the rats. The fatty acids obtained from alcohol-insoble Li-salts were largely solid with some exceptions, being seemed to be C_<16-20> acids from the neutralizatiion values ; noted also the spots of unsaturated fatty acids on the chromatograms. The fatty acids obtained from water-soluble Li-salts were viscous or resinous, in any case, showed an exceptionally lower neutraliation value than others. The sodium hydroxide solutions of these acids disclosed the positive reduction reactions of sugars, namely, Fehling, Benedict, Tollen and Schiff reactions ; carbonyl numbers were variable by the acids. The experimental results of fatty acids by paper chromatography, indicated the plural or single spots. At all events, the fatty acids obtained from the water-soluble Li-salts, were distinguishable from other acids and we take a special interest.
